Lincoln Tunnel Challenge

This Sunday more than 3,000 people will run through the Lincoln Tunnel to raise funds for Special Olympics New Jersey.
The USATF certified 5K race, the Lincoln Tunnel Challenge, begins at the south tube of the tunnel in Weehawken. Participants then run or walk through the tunnel to NYC and back.
Online registration is closed but participants can still register onsite.
The event is taking place this Sunday, April 25th. Runners with 5K finish times of under 25 minutes will start at 8 a.m. All other participants will start at 8:45 a.m. Rain or shine!
The event, in its 24th year, and benefits the more than 21,000 athletes with intellectual disabilities that train and compete in New Jersey year round. The Lincoln Tunnel Challenge is presented by AmeriHealth New Jersey; hosted by the Port Authority NY/NJ; and sponsored by the Law Enforcement Torch Run for Special Olympics New Jersey.
